The Status Quo: Traditional Drug Approval is Slow and Costly

Before AI surged onto the scene, FDA drug approvals often took years, involving exhaustive clinical trials and data analysis. This cautious pace, while necessary for safety, delays access to innovative therapies, including drugs that could enhance fertility or support the conception journey.

For hopeful parents relying on at-home fertility aids, this lag can feel especially disheartening. While clinical treatments evolve slowly, many turn to disruptive at-home technologies to fill the gap.

Enter AI: The Catalyst for Rapid Innovation

AI’s potential to analyze vast datasets, identify patterns, and predict outcomes is transforming healthcare—and regulatory agencies like the FDA are beginning to take notice. Machine learning algorithms can simulate drug interactions, forecast side effects, and optimize clinical trial designs with unprecedented speed and accuracy.

If AI accelerates FDA approvals, we could see a new wave of fertility drugs and adjuncts hitting the market faster, providing more options tailored to individual needs.

Well, buckle up, because the recent FDA approval of Yeztugo, a twice-yearly HIV prevention drug, is shaking things up in the health and fertility tech worlds in ways you might not expect.

If you haven’t caught wind of this yet, Gizmodo just reported on this FDA breakthrough drug Yeztugo that promises to be a game-changer in pre-exposure prophylaxis — effectively lowering the risk of HIV transmission with just two doses a year. That’s right, no daily pills, just twice yearly injections with remarkable effectiveness.
